Only 37% of developers trust AI for incident response, far below the optimism seen among IT and business leaders.
The gap highlights a risk: leadership may push AI adoption faster than engineers are willing to use it in real outages.
The article says organizations need to build trust through transparency, validation, and human oversight.
Targeted reskilling could help teams use AI for incident detection and response, reducing alert fatigue and burnout.
